Transaction 23acfacb71d9a57b33ff5581146016a96d840c37a93cb84f47823092bf7149a0
2 Input
2 Outputs
- 23acfacb71d9a57b33ff5581146016a96d840c37a93cb84f47823092bf7149a0:0
- 23acfacb71d9a57b33ff5581146016a96d840c37a93cb84f47823092bf7149a0:1
value 120654037
address 3QZp7sCknDZ7wmLW4ij46dyAtAYEbZbuFM
value 79035963
address 3BMEXn2mWhMj81BvAaJn9aQqrYz8uTnzfd